I absolutely loved working with Susan from Emery's. She was the most helpful and patient vendor with whom I worked. Instead of having a regular unity candle, we bought a vase and had it inscribed and it was supposed to be a floating candle. Well, during my move the week of the wedding it got cracked and I (naturally) panicked. Susan remained very calm and she didn't even mind when I requested that we switch colors in the unity candle arrangement to match the new candle we had to have. She truly was my saving grace and allowed for me to keep my head on straight! The bridesmaid flowers were so beautiful. They were simple hydrangeas and they came out beautifully. I was somewhat saddened by the fact that they couldn't get ivy for our centerpieces at the last minute, but they came out fine and we had a lot of compliments on the centerpieces in their Eiffel Tower vases so that was fantastic. The flowers all kept their color and life throughout the entire day with the exception of the unity candle arrangement, but I believe that was because they were not able to be water sourced. All in all, I was EXTREMELY happy with Emery's and I really recommend them!
I fell in love with Atlas the first time I went there and met Nicole. I went to a total of 8 other bridal stores just looking for the perfect dress, but all along I knew I wanted to buy it from Atlas. I ended up finding THE dress in Sandusky, so I called Atlas and asked if they could order it for me and they did. They kept it there until the wedding weekend and took care of my Mom's dress and my bridesmaid dresses as well. In addition, I ordered my girls each a shaw that Atlas made for them.
Their service is far superior to that of the other 7 places I went for dresses. They were patient and kind and sent cards in the mail to let you know what was going on or just to thank you for stopping in! I received a phone call two weeks before my bridesmaids' dresses were going to go up in price just to let me know so I could tell the girls to get their orders in before the change. The women who work there are always dressed to the nines and they are ready and willing to help out with any problems or questions you may have.
I did not like going dress shopping at certain chain stores that were pushy and rushed. I was very displeased with the fact that some stores would only allow for you to have three dresses out at a time in a cramped little dressing room. Nicole at Atlas would bring in as many dresses as I asked her to and she wouldn't mind at all. Plus Atlas has beautiful, large dressing rooms with reception lighting. I loved, Loved, LOVED working with Atlas. I can only hope that when I am a bridesmaid in other weddings that the dresses will be ordered through them as well!
I absolutely LOVED having Decorative Sound. I spent months researching everything from florists to cake, but when it came to the DJ I went SOLELY on the references from theknot.com and all of them were screaming "HIRE DECORATIVE SOUND!" We booked them after meeting Mike for about 45 minutes. Although they cost slightly more than some of the DJs in the area, they are WAY worth it. Mike really helped us pick the perfect music and keep things moving for our reception.
Our actual DJ, Rob, was fantastic. He handed me a water as soon as I got out of the limo and stepped foot into the reception hall. We had the best compliments about the dinner music and the dancing. The dinner music was a mix of my style and some of their classics and it was blended perfectly. During my Maid of Honor's toast which related to a song that she and I share together, Rob started playing the song ever so softly in the background and it just topped the whole thing off.
We had a wedding one month after ours and Mike was the DJ. Not only did he remember us, he remembered our "first dance" song and he played it for us. That meant so much to us.
I am so happy we worked with Mike and Rob and Decorative Sound. I know a lot of people say this, but we had more compliments about our DJ than anything else. They are worth every penny and more!!!!!
I loved working with The Birds and The Bees. They did marvelous work on my invitations! The only thing I was sort of upset about was the fact that there was a misprint on our envelopes. The printing company (NOT Birds and the Bees) messed up. Well, B&B said they threw away all of the envelopes that had the wrong address on them but they didn't. So my Mother and I addressed about 50 envelopes before noticing they were the wrong ones because we believed them when they told us they had thrown all the bad ones away. I guess that's our fault for not double-checking. Other than that ONE thing, everything was fabulous.

Although Shamas is sort of pricey, they have fabulous service and I really recommend them. You get treated like royalty when you are there! It's fun to be pampered!
I worked with both Jen (makeup) and Julie (hair). I really enjoy both of these ladies. They were very calm and cool under the pressure of our constant photography during the day of the wedding. On the day of the wedding, I decided to alter my hair style from what we had talked about during the trial and Julie was fine with that. She pulled off the look I was going for perfectly. Jenn kept me calm, made me laugh, and really seemed easy going when it came to the numerous interruptions that took place on the big day. She is also incredibly talented. Between the two of them, I felt and looked like a princess. :-)
